Summary of Bill HRES 331
The bill "Supporting the goals and ideals of 'National Youth HIV/AIDS Awareness Day'" was introduced in the 119th Congress on April 10, 2025. This bill, designated as H.Res. 331, aims to endorse and promote the objectives and values of "National Youth HIV/AIDS Awareness Day," though specific provisions or directives are not detailed in the provided context.
Current Status of Bill HRES 331
Bill HRES 331 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since April 10, 2025. Bill HRES 331 was introduced during Congress 119 and was introduced to the House on April 10, 2025. Bill HRES 331's most recent activity was Referred to the House Committee on Energy and Commerce. as of April 10, 2025
